Essential Duties/Job Qualifications As part of the qualification process for the Armed Driver Guard position, a Human Performance Evaluation (HPE) is required. This evaluation requires successful completion of testing in the following areas:Lift:- 25lbs vertical lift from 10 inches to 66 inches from the floor (1X) Lift-Carry:- 18lbs vertical lift from 1 inch to 44 inches from the floor, and horizontally transfer 15ft (4X)- 18lbs vertical lift from 10 inches to 36 inches from the floor and horizontally transfer 300ft (1X)- 50lbs vertical lift from 10 inches to 36 inches from the floor and horizontally transfer 2ft (2X) Push-Pull:- Horizontally transfer 47lbs of force on a sled (single, non-dominant arm), a distance of 1ft (2X) Repetitive Coupling:- Squeeze Jamar Hand Dynamometer requiring forces up to 30lbs / both right & left hands (4X) Climb:- Ascend / Descend a step with heights of 16. 21 & 24 inches from the floor (10X) Benefits

Definition of Class
* This position is responsible for the care, custody and control of incarcerated offenders committed to the Erie County Department of Corrections. This is inclusive of the main prison and the Community Corrections Center.
Duties & Responsibilities
* Communicate with and manage inmates by orienting new commitments with rules, procedures and general information of the facility
* Enforce all rules and regulations as well as sanctions for any violations
* Conduct cell inspections for contraband, damage and cleanliness
* Observe, monitor and supervise offender movement, escort offenders in groups and restrict movement during scheduled counts and emergencies
* Maintain key, tool and equipment control by inspecting, reporting, and taking inventory
* Maintain health, safety and sanitation standards
* Communicate professionally with staff and offenders
* Document incidents and write complete, concise and accurate reports
